JBL’s New Endurance Headphones Are Built for Training, Running, and Gym Workouts
The world of sports audio has taken a significant leap forward with JBL’s latest lineup, the Endurance series. This collection of headphones is designed specifically for athletes and fitness enthusiasts, offering innovative features that cater to different needs and preferences.
At the heart of the Endurance series lies the Endurance Zone, JBL’s first open-ear sports headphone. The Endurance Zone uses JBL OpenSound Technology to deliver deep bass while minimizing sound leakage, ensuring users remain aware of their surroundings during high-intensity workouts. Liquid silicone ear hooks with adaptable memory wire provide a secure fit even during intense movements.
A key feature of the Endurance Zone is its commitment to environmental awareness. By allowing air conduction, JBL OpenSound Technology enables users to stay connected to their surroundings without compromising sound quality. This is particularly valuable for athletes who need situational awareness during competitions or high-stakes training sessions.
In terms of performance, the Endurance Zone boasts impressive battery life, with 32 hours of total playback time from both earbuds and the charging case. Speed Charge technology allows users to recharge their earbuds and enjoy up to 3 hours of playback in just 10 minutes. Four microphones with dual beamforming on each bud ensure clear calls and voice isolation.

For those who prefer wired headphones, the Endurance Run 3 is an excellent option. Available in two versions – USB-C and 3.5mm – this headphone offers impressive sound quality with 8mm dynamic drivers that deliver rich bass and clear vocals. The USB-C version supports Hi-Res Audio, making it a great choice for audiophiles.
The Endurance Run 3 features TwistLock enhancers for a secure fit as well as FlipHook flexible design magnetic buds that provide comfort during long workouts. Both versions are IP65 certified, ensuring they can withstand intense exercise and environmental conditions.
Pricing
The Endurance Zone is priced at $179.95 in Black with Grey and White colors. The Peak 4 is priced at $129.95 in Black with Grey, Purple, and White colors. The Endurance Pace costs $89.95 in Black with Grey, making it an excellent entry-point for those looking to upgrade their sports audio experience.
The Endurance Run 3 USB-C version costs $34.95, while the 3.5mm version costs $24.95, both available in Black with Grey colors. The Endurance Zone, Peak 4, and Pace will launch on JBL.com in January 2026, while the Endurance Run 3 will be available in February 2026.
